Output 17fe50a0dc905db55933742fec31ee624c730b20533699895637174dd689adb4:0

value
28520423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66da1f1188d7d7fea628acb57a3d003915138517 OP_EQUAL
address
MHGzTLNQNw9MrUVCnBpyLpbd8gC7abaSPT
transaction
17fe50a0dc905db55933742fec31ee624c730b20533699895637174dd689adb4
spent
true